  • 2 1/2 cups whole milk
  • 3 large eggs
  • 1 3/4 cups plus 2 tablespoons flour
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
  • 1 9.6-ounce package precooked sausage links
  • 4 scallions, thinly sliced

Recipe Method

1. Place a baking sheet in the oven and preheat to 400 degrees. Using a blender, mix the milk and eggs for 10 seconds. Blend in the flour and salt for 2 minutes. Let rest.

2. Meanwhile, in a large cast-iron or other heavy, ovenproof skillet, heat the olive oil over high heat. Place the sausage links in the pan and cook, turning occasionally, until browned and heated through, about 5 minutes. Sprinkle with the scallions, pour the egg batter over the sausages and remove from the heat.

3. Place the skillet on the baking sheet and bake until puffed and browned, about 45 minutes. Serve hot.
